The Silent Pressure Behind Global Egg Dehydration
What most people overlook is how sensitive egg dehydration really is to upstream agricultural conditions. Temperature fluctuations, feed quality variations, and regional disease outbreaks all cascade into inconsistencies that ripple through processing plants. This is where industrial egg dehydration quality control issues in manufacturing begin to surface in subtle but costly ways, often forcing processors to recalibrate entire production batches.
From an expertise standpoint, dehydration is not merely a preservation method but a precision-driven transformation. Even a slight deviation in moisture control can alter protein functionality, leading to unpredictable behavior in bakery mixes, sauces, or protein formulations. Manufacturers working at scale often underestimate how tightly engineered this process must be, which is why many experience recurring batch variability despite standardized protocols.

Storage Reality vs Industry Assumptions
One of the most misunderstood aspects of this market is storage behavior over time. Many assume powdered egg products are inherently stable for long durations, but real-world conditions tell a more nuanced story. Oxidation, microclimate variation, and packaging integrity all play silent roles in determining usable lifespan.
This gap between assumption and reality is where many operational inefficiencies begin. Facilities that do not actively monitor environmental conditions often experience gradual quality decline without immediate detection. Over time, this affects emulsification properties, baking consistency, and even nutritional labeling accuracy.
In industrial applications, these subtle shifts matter more than most realize. A slight change in protein denaturation behavior can alter entire product formulations, forcing reformulation cycles that consume both time and resources.
What Forward-Looking Buyers Are Changing
The most resilient players in this space are no longer treating dried egg ingredients as passive commodities. Instead, they are building tighter supplier audits, investing in predictive supply chain modeling, and prioritizing processors with advanced dehydration monitoring systems.
They are also shifting toward integrated sourcing strategies that account for regional production risks rather than relying on single-origin supply. This approach reduces exposure to sudden disruptions and creates more stable procurement pipelines.
Another emerging behavior is deeper technical collaboration with suppliers. Instead of transactional purchasing, companies are engaging in joint quality validation programs, ensuring that processing standards align with end-use requirements from the beginning.
These shifts are not just operational improvements; they represent a fundamental rethinking of how ingredient reliability is defined in modern food manufacturing.
